Description
Mullein (Verbascum) is an herbal remedy best known for supporting respiratory health. Its leaves and flowers act as an expectorant to loosen mucus, while its mucilage content soothes inflamed airways and sore throats. It also offers antibacterial and antiviral properties. [1, 2, 3]
Respiratory Support
- Loosens Mucus: Acts as an expectorant, helping to thin and expel thick phlegm from the airways and lungs.
- Soothes Inflammation: Rich in mucilage, which coats the throat and bronchial tubes to relieve coughing and irritation.
- Combats Infection: Contains flavonoids and saponins that show promising antibacterial and antiviral properties in early studies. [1, 2, 3]

How to Use
Mullein is consumed or applied in several formats:
- Mullein Tea: Drinking tea provides almost immediate relief (30 minutes to 2 hours) for sore throats and chest congestion. Always use a strainer or tea bag, as the tiny hairs on the leaves can irritate the throat if unfiltered.
- Extracts and Capsules: Concentrated forms often used for daily immune and lung support.
- Oils and Salves: Used directly on the skin for irritation or earaches
